Cross-Channel Marketing Automation with Interactive Content

Cross-channel marketing automation is about seamlessly integrating various online and offline channels to promote a cohesive brand experience. It combines data-driven insights and targeted content strategies to engage customers effectively across multiple touchpoints. With the increasing consumption of interactive content, utilizing technologies that allow for such experiences can significantly enhance customer interaction and retention. This approach focuses on automating user interactions through engaging quizzes, polls, surveys, and dynamic landing pages that adapt to users’ responses. Implementing such strategies can streamline marketing workflows and deliver personalized content based on user behavior. Marketers can collect and analyze data for thorough insights into customer preferences and behaviors. Studies have shown that companies prioritizing customer engagement through interactive content have seen notable improvements in their conversion rates. For businesses, this may mean the difference between stagnation and significant growth. By leveraging tools that facilitate this automation process, companies enhance their marketing strategies, providing a better return on investment. Hence, the future of marketing may rely heavily on interactive content that revolutionizes the way brands communicate with their audiences.

The Benefits of Interactive Content

Adopting interactive content into a marketing strategy is not just a trend; it brings distinct benefits that improve the overall customer journey. These activities can invite active participation, thereby enhancing user experience significantly. People are naturally drawn to interactive elements that make content more engaging, and they tend to remember information better when they participate in the story. This is particularly beneficial in building brand loyalty and encouraging sharing through social networks. One way to utilize this advantage is through creation of shareable quizzes related to the brand. Users are likely to share results with their own connections, which amplifies reach. Additionally, interactive content generates valuable insights by collecting real-time feedback that can inform content strategies. This helps marketers tailor communications and offerings more precisely to audience expectations. Metrics derived from user interactions can also help optimize campaigns for success. Furthermore, appealing interactive content can convert leads more efficiently by guiding users along their buyer’s journey with tailored calls to action that lead to conversion paths. In every way, enriching customer interaction can translate to greater business success and satisfaction.

One of the main challenges of marketing automation with interactive content lies in the choice of platforms and integration capabilities. Marketers must choose tools that easily synchronize across customer relationship management (CRM) systems and other marketing channels. This ensures that the gathered data can be utilized effectively without manual data entry errors. Platforms should allow for easy content creation and modification even without extensive technical skills. User-friendly interfaces help marketing teams focus more on strategy than execution. Additionally, maintaining a consistent brand voice across all channels while using different formats of interactive content is essential. Tools that allow dynamic content customization based on user data solve this issue effectively. Furthermore, thorough testing is necessary to understand how varied audiences respond to the interactive marketing materials. Brands need to track metrics like user engagement rates and conversion statistics to ensure that marketing efforts yield positive returns. Optimizing content based on observed behaviors will lead to improved strategies and higher engagement over time. Businesses are advised to ensure that their marketing automation tools support seamless integration and customization to enable efficient campaigns and outreach.

Content personalization plays a significant role in the success of interactive marketing automation efforts. When users receive customized experiences that reflect their preferences and behaviors, their likelihood of engagement increases. This can include using personalized messaging in quizzes, adapting survey questions based on previous interactions, or dynamically showing content relating to user interests. By showing customers that their preferences are understood, brands can cultivate trust and loyalty. Segmentation techniques allow for advanced personalization that considers various user characteristics, leading to greater specificity in targeting. Furthermore, responsive design ensures that interactive content serves users effectively across devices, whether on their laptops or smartphones. Investing in technology that implements these capabilities will yield substantial dividends in user engagement. Additionally, brands must continuously monitor and analyze the performance of personalized content to optimize future campaigns. Marketing teams need to embrace agile methodologies to remain flexible in addressing changing user needs. Automation can streamline these adjustments based on user feedback and analytics. The goal is to create interactive marketing experiences that reinforce brand connections while fostering long-term consumer relationships.

As the market evolves, so does the need for brands to stay ahead of emerging trends in interactive content. Technologies such as augmented reality (AR) and virtual reality (VR) are promising avenues for immersive experiences. Integrating these innovative formats into marketing strategies can captivate and engage audiences in unprecedented ways. AR applications provide users with virtual representations that enhance real-world interactions, offering exciting advertising possibilities. Brands can create unique virtual experiences, such as allowing users to visualize products in their environments through smartphone applications. Similarly, VR environments can be curated to provide rich, interactive storytelling experiences that fully engage users. However, deploying such advanced technologies necessitates significant investment in both time and resources to execute successfully. Marketers must also consider usability, ensuring that any created interactive experiences are intuitive and user-friendly. Education on these new interactive formats alongside traditional content must also occur to ensure all potential users can uptake the change. Gradually implementing these trends into marketing strategies can allow brands to ride the wave of innovation while reaching modern consumer expectations through engaging experiences.
